Account recovery for the Nightglass admin dashboard must be performed from the dark-mode theme settings panel, as the light-mode variant caches stale session tokens. Verify the reviewer toggle renders correctly before proceeding, since a misrendered contrast state has previously masked the recovery prompt. Once the panel loads, enter the passphrase shown below.

vault phrase of taweg-kafof = oliax-zorael

Fan-out backpressure for the Quillet notifier: when the queue depth crosses the soft limit, the dispatcher sheds low-priority pushes and batches the rest at 500ms intervals. Reviewer should confirm the shed counter is exported and that retries respect the jitter window. Once merged, the release artifact gets re-signed by the pipeline, which expects the deploy key shown below.

deploy key for bawep-yawif: bky6_GQhaSt

# Runbook: Hunting leaked file descriptors in Quillgate

When the `fd_open` gauge climbs steadily between deploys, suspect a leak rather than load. First confirm on a single pod: exec in and count entries under `/proc/1/fd`, noting how many are sockets in CLOSE_WAIT versus regular files. Capture two snapshots ten minutes apart before restarting anything — we need the delta for the postmortem. Reproduce locally with the Marbury load harness, which requires the service running with the following configuration values.

settings of yagep-bajog:
[istdor]
port = 4000
region = south-2
host = istdor.qorvelcorp.internal
timeout_ms = 5000
retries = 5

- [ ] **Step 7: Breaker override escrow.** After sealing the signing keys for the Tallgrove upstream API circuit breaker, confirm the support team can force the breaker open during a full outage. The override bundle lives in the sealed escrow drawer and is useless without its unlock phrase. Two ceremony witnesses must initial this step before proceeding. The escrow bundle is decrypted with the recovery passphrase that follows.

vault phrase of kahip-kahop = holath-quenmir